
Lips of Blood
Directed by Jean Rollin
Memories of a mysterious woman leads a man to free a group of female vampires in Jean Rollin’s sensuous and scary vampire tale. Frederic is at a party with his mother when a photo on the wall triggers a long-dormant childhood memory of encountering a woman at a chateau. Though his mother says he’s imagining things, Frederic’s obsession leads him on a quest to uncover the truth, even if people die in the process. A vivid encapsulation of Rollin’s trademark themes of memory, childhood, and romantic obsession, LIPS OF BLOOD is essential viewing for Euro-horror fans.
